public JsonResult _ExpertsList(int draw, int start = 0, int length = 2, int CategoryId = 0) { string search = Request.Form["search[value]"]; string order_by = Request.Form["columns[" + Request.Form["order[0][column]"] + "][data]"]; string order_dir = Request.Form["order[0][dir]"]; DataTableViewModel result = new DataTableViewModel(); result.draw = draw; int total_count; result.data = vacancyService.GetExperts(out total_count, start, length, search, order_by, order_dir); result.recordsTotal = total_count; result.recordsFiltered = total_count; return Json(result); }
public JsonResult _ReportsList(int draw, int start = 0, int length = 2, int CategoryId = 0) { DBContext.Configuration.LazyLoadingEnabled = false; string search = Request.Form["search[value]"]; string order_by = Request.Form["columns[" + Request.Form["order[0][column]"] + "][data]"]; string order_dir = Request.Form["order[0][dir]"]; DataTableViewModel result = new DataTableViewModel(); result.draw = draw; int total_count; result.data = financialService.GetFinancialReports(out total_count, start, length, search, order_by, order_dir); result.recordsTotal = total_count; result.recordsFiltered = total_count; return Json(result); }
public JsonResult _KeyIssuesList(int draw, int start = 0, int length = 2, int TopicId = 0) { string search = Request.Form["search[value]"]; string order_by = Request.Form["columns[" + Request.Form["order[0][column]"] + "][data]"]; string order_dir = Request.Form["order[0][dir]"]; DataTableViewModel result = new DataTableViewModel(); result.draw = draw; int total_count; result.data = keyIssueService.GetKeyIssues(out total_count, TopicId, start, length, search, order_by, order_dir,true); result.recordsTotal = total_count; result.recordsFiltered = total_count; return Json(result); }